Leave behind Windows
This commit is contained in:
19
aquabot.py
19
aquabot.py
@@ -12,21 +12,22 @@ import logging
|
|||||||
from datetime import datetime
|
from datetime import datetime
|
||||||
import platform
|
import platform
|
||||||
import random
|
import random
|
||||||
|
import asyncio
|
||||||
|
|
||||||
# IMPORTS - internal
|
# IMPORTS - internal
|
||||||
import loadconfig
|
import loadconfig
|
||||||
|
|
||||||
# LOGGING
|
# LOGGING
|
||||||
logger = logging.getLogger("discord")
|
#logger = logging.getLogger("discord")
|
||||||
# https://docs.python.org/3/library/logging.html#levels
|
# https://docs.python.org/3/library/logging.html#levels
|
||||||
logger.setLevel(logging.INFO)
|
#logger.setLevel(logging.INFO)
|
||||||
handler = logging.FileHandler(
|
#handler = logging.FileHandler(
|
||||||
filename="logs/discord-{%Y-%m-%d_%H-%M}.log".format(datetime.now()),
|
# filename="logs/discord.log",
|
||||||
encoding="utf-8",
|
# encoding="utf-8",
|
||||||
mode="w")
|
# mode="w")
|
||||||
handler.setFormatter(
|
#handler.setFormatter(
|
||||||
logging.Formatter("%(asctime)s:%(levelname)s:%(name)s: %(message)s"))
|
# logging.Formatter("%(asctime)s:%(levelname)s:%(name)s: %(message)s"))
|
||||||
logger.addHandler(handler)
|
#logger.addHandler(handler)
|
||||||
|
|
||||||
# INIT THE BOT
|
# INIT THE BOT
|
||||||
bot = commands.Bot(
|
bot = commands.Bot(
|
||||||
|
|||||||
2
config/config.py
Normal file
2
config/config.py
Normal file
@@ -0,0 +1,2 @@
|
|||||||
|
__token__ = "NjIzMjA4NzgyOTY0NDU3NTAz.XYD_RQ.qQqLIeq_5XmjV0MOqv5H7Cb8LSo"
|
||||||
|
__prefix__ = "."
|
||||||
@@ -2,16 +2,6 @@
|
|||||||
Media, which can be accessed from the bot.
|
Media, which can be accessed from the bot.
|
||||||
"""
|
"""
|
||||||
|
|
||||||
# Exports
|
|
||||||
__media_anime__ = [gifs_anime, pics_anime]
|
|
||||||
|
|
||||||
__media_waifu__ = {
|
|
||||||
"aqua": waifu_aqua,
|
|
||||||
"meugmin": waifu_megumin,
|
|
||||||
"akeno": waifu_akeno,
|
|
||||||
"rem": waifu_rem
|
|
||||||
}
|
|
||||||
|
|
||||||
# Internal lists
|
# Internal lists
|
||||||
gifs_anime = []
|
gifs_anime = []
|
||||||
|
|
||||||
@@ -26,3 +16,14 @@ waifu_megumin = []
|
|||||||
waifu_akeno = []
|
waifu_akeno = []
|
||||||
|
|
||||||
waifu_rem = []
|
waifu_rem = []
|
||||||
|
|
||||||
|
|
||||||
|
# Exports
|
||||||
|
__media_anime__ = [gifs_anime, pics_anime]
|
||||||
|
|
||||||
|
__media_waifu__ = {
|
||||||
|
"aqua": waifu_aqua,
|
||||||
|
"meugmin": waifu_megumin,
|
||||||
|
"akeno": waifu_akeno,
|
||||||
|
"rem": waifu_rem
|
||||||
|
}
|
||||||
|
|||||||
@@ -2,13 +2,14 @@
|
|||||||
The bot's online status rotates through this list
|
The bot's online status rotates through this list
|
||||||
"""
|
"""
|
||||||
|
|
||||||
|
import discord
|
||||||
|
|
||||||
__activity__ = [
|
__activity__ = [
|
||||||
(discord.ActivityType.watching, "Hentai"),
|
(discord.ActivityType.watching, "Hentai"),
|
||||||
(discord.ActivityType.watching, "Konosuba"),
|
(discord.ActivityType.watching, "Konosuba"),
|
||||||
(discord.ActivityType.watching, "beach episodes")
|
(discord.ActivityType.watching, "beach episodes"),
|
||||||
(discord.ActivityType.playing, "with water")
|
(discord.ActivityType.playing, "with water"),
|
||||||
(discord.ActivityType.playing, "with Megumin"),
|
(discord.ActivityType.playing, "with Megumin"),
|
||||||
(discord.ActivityType.playing, "with Sake"),
|
(discord.ActivityType.playing, "with Sake"),
|
||||||
(discord.ActivityType.streaming, "Hentai")
|
(discord.ActivityType.streaming, "Hentai")
|
||||||
(discord.ActivityType.custom, "mizu")
|
|
||||||
]
|
]
|
||||||
|
|||||||
@@ -20,6 +20,8 @@ try:
|
|||||||
|
|
||||||
except yaml.YAMLError as error:
|
except yaml.YAMLError as error:
|
||||||
print(f"Error while parsing: {error}")
|
print(f"Error while parsing: {error}")
|
||||||
|
except FileNotFoundError as error:
|
||||||
|
print(f"Error, please create a config file: {error}")
|
||||||
|
|
||||||
try:
|
try:
|
||||||
from config.cogs import __cogs__
|
from config.cogs import __cogs__
|
||||||
|
|||||||
@@ -1,2 +1,3 @@
|
|||||||
discord.py[voice]=1.2.5
|
discord.py[voice]=1.2.5
|
||||||
youtube-dl
|
youtube-dl
|
||||||
|
pyyaml
|
||||||
Reference in New Issue
Block a user